Dipentaerythrityl Hexahydroxystearate
Function: Skin Conditioning, Viscosity Controlling, Viscosity Increasing Agent, Emulsifying, Smoothing
1. Definition Dipentaerythrityl Hexahydroxystearate:
Dipentaerythrityl Hexahydroxystearate is a synthetic compound commonly used in cosmetics as an emollient and skin conditioning agent. It is derived from pentaerythritol, a polyol used in the production of alkyd resins, and stearic acid, a saturated fatty acid commonly found in animal and vegetable fats.2. Use:
Dipentaerythrityl Hexahydroxystearate is primarily used in cosmetics as a thickening agent and emollient to improve the texture and feel of skincare and makeup products. It helps to hydrate and soften the skin, leaving it smooth and supple. Additionally, it can also act as a binding agent to help other ingredients in the formulation adhere to the skin more effectively.3. Usage Dipentaerythrityl Hexahydroxystearate:
